Question

A train is moving with a uniform speed of 120 km per hour.
(i) How far will it travel in 36 minutes?
(ii) In how much time will it cover 210 km?

Sum
Advertisements

Solution

(i) Speed of train in 60 minutes = 120 km

i.e. distance covered in 60 minutes =`120/60`

Distance covered in 36 minutes =`(120xx36)/60`

= 2 × 36

= 72 km

(ii) If distance covered is 120 km then the time is taken = 60 minutes

 If distance covered is 1 km then the time is taken =`60/120`

If the distance covered is 210 km then the time is taken =`60/120xx210` = 105 minutes

= 1 hours 45 minutes
